Practice deep breathing when trying to sleep. This deep breathing really works to relax your whole body. That may put you right to sleep. Breathe deeply and repeatedly. Breathe in through the nose, out through the mouth. These sort of exercises may seem difficult at first, but you will feel your body get relaxed.

There are many foods that contain tryptophan which is a natural sleep aid. If you consume these foods before bed, you will have an easier time getting to sleep. Some examples of foods like these are warm milk, cottage cheese, turkey, eggs, and cashews. Cold milk won’t cut it, though.

Don’t force yourself to sleep when you’re an insomniac. It’s important to go to bed when you are feeling tired instead. Adopting a more regular schedule will help you get rid of your insomnia but you should not force yourself to go to sleep if you are not ready to.

If you’re going to exercise in the evenings, make sure it is well before bedtime. Morning exercise is also a great idea. Doing it too close to bed time can rev up your metabolism. You need time to wind down.

If you’re having trouble with insomnia, you may be causing it because of the environment you’re sleeping in. The room you sleep in should be cool, dark and . Heat, noise and light all can cause you to stay awake when you want to sleep. Should you face outside noise, make use of white noise from sound machines or a fan to cover the noise. The fan will not only cover the noise, but also keep you cool. Blackout curtains or a sleeping mask may be helpful for blocking out any light.
